The Inner Harbor (English for Inner Harbor , inland port ; Spanish Puerto Interior ) is a small natural harbor in the group of Melchior Islands in the West Antarctic Palmer Archipelago . It is bordered in a semicircle by the lambda , epsilon , alpha and delta islands .

The descriptive name was probably given by scientists from the British Discovery Investigations , who roughly measured it in 1927. Argentine expeditions made further surveys in 1942, 1943 and 1948.
